Middle/High School English Teacher

Stride Learning
United States
Workplace: RemoteFull timeUSD 45,000 - 50,000 annuallyFunction: Education & TrainingEducation: bachelorsSkills: ["Communication","Independent work","Collaboration"]

Deliver synchronous and asynchronous English instruction in a fully virtual setting, personalizing learning and differentiating by student mastery. Monitor progress through the Stride K12 learning management system, maintain accurate grade books, and support placement and promotion decisions. Communicate regularly with students and families/learning coaches, troubleshoot in a virtual classroom, and prepare students for standardized testing. Travel occasionally for testing and professional development.
